M4.9 Earthquake 25 km NNW of Āwash, Ethiopia — January 8, 2025
2025-01-08 22:07:41 UTC (2025-01-08) · approx. 1:07 AM UTC+3 local
Felt by 4 people across nearby locations.
On January 8, 2025 at 22:07 UTC, a magnitude 4.9 shallow crustal earthquake struck 25 km NNW of Āwash, Ethiopia, at a depth of 10.0 km and coordinates 9.1826°, 40.0417°. This earthquake was detected by 113 seismic stations with excellent location accuracy and was assigned a USGS significance rating of 371, placing it among routine seismic activity.
Physical scale: An earthquake of magnitude 4.9 releases seismic energy equivalent to roughly 338 metric tons of TNT. Empirical fault-scaling laws (Wells & Coppersmith, 1994) estimate the subsurface rupture length at approximately 1.4 km — a useful intuition for the size of the slip patch on the fault.
